What are the characteristics of a good schedule? Accurate mapping of inputs and outputs Correct sequencing of events Accurate estimation of activity duration and resources needed to perform those activities Proactive identification of project risks, constraints, and dependencies What can we learn from PMBoK to improve our scheduling techniques? Proposal Manager have a difficult job planning a schedule with so many changing variables (changing requirements, due dates, and resources)? Advance Planning - Try to stay ahead of the curve, start your first line of defense by creating a pipeline. Create schedule templates for common proposal turnarounds like 10, 15, 30, and 45 day proposal schedules. Establish agreements with vendors in advance to provide supplies, proposal personnel, production services, etc. Develop and revise your schedule using these techniques: Define your “critical path” – what must be done to reach the end goal (proposal delivery on schedule). Define two paths to reaching the end goal; Plan A and Plan B. Activities on the critical path can not be delayed. Examples include questions for the Contracting Officer, past performance questionnaires for the contracting officer, internal decision gate, and the proposal delivery date. Try “crashing” - add more resources to activities on the critical path like additional resume writers. Try “fast tracking” – tasks normally done in sequence are done in parallel or iteratively. In the early stages this could be capture and pre-proposal development activities and in the later stages technical and management solution development activities. I normally don’t use float and leveling might not be as relevant. We usually don’t have a lot of float or excess in our schedule and people are already giving 110%. If available use Microsoft Project resources to facilitate program scheduling. Manage to your schedule; proactively monitor activities. Report status daily Record planned vs. actual

Use PMBoK techniques to estimate costs accurately, an average 30-day proposal can easily cost $175-200K ( a capture manger, proposal manager, graphics, 3 SMEs, reviewers) Cost Estimating Techniques Use Analogous Estimates – use your historical data to predict cost of the proposal. Create baseline budgets for producing proposals on 5, 10, 30 and 45 day schedules based on historic evidence. Use Bottom-Up Estimating – define each WBS activity and add up the costs of those activities 2. Typical Items Covered in a Budget include: Labor (In-house, contractor) Materials - Binders/Tabs/Pens Travel Production Leave at least 10% cushion for a well-planned proposal, and twice – four times as much for a proposal that is not well planned

Communications represent a significant part >20-50% of a proposal manager’s day. Create a plan to manage communications.
Role and Responsibilities: Everyone on the proposal team should understand their roles and responsibilities for proposal communications, and know who, when, where, and how to provide status. Proposal Communications: Typical proposal communications include proposal kick-off meetings, daily stand-up reviews, status and financial reports, questions for the Contracting Officer, discussions with subcontractors and vendors, and interviews with key personnel and subject matter experts. There are two types of risks. Risk inherent in the solution of your proposal and those associated with proposal management. The Shipley book focuses nicely on risks to your solution, I also focus on risks to the management of your proposal. As in the case of the Communications Plan, prepare a standard Risk Management plan for your proposal group and a risk log for a particular proposal proposal. The Risk Management Plan should address roles and responsibilities, risk criticality (high, medium, low), likelihood of occurrence (high, medium low), and escalation paths. Identify risks: lack of key personnel, good past performance references, complete technical solution, price to win strategy, single point of failure production resources. For example, you have only 1 color laser printer – 3 years of age. If functions well most of the time, but has been known to cause trouble. Define who is responsible for its continued operation. Define its criticality (high) and likelihood of occurrence (medium). Define your escalation path if the printer fails. Define your mitigation plan (pre-servicing before big job, extra time in the schedule to address issues, agreement with printing vendor, etc.) Use a risk log during daily stand up meetings to identify, discuss, and resolve risks. Risk Response: If after several proposal the same risks appear, bring them up to senior management for resolution or remediation. Also try to transfer negative risk – through pre-planning, agreements with vendors, proposal consultants, etc.

Our traditional proposal development process (pictured on the left) is similar to the SW development waterfall method. I follows a prescribed pattern resulting in a completed proposal or piece of software at the end. Iterative, agile, and spiral methods take a different approach focusing on the rapid and often parallel development of components in no sequential order; often building on from the core out. These software development techniques have several thing in common with proposal development, they have to produce a finished product on schedule and within budget following specific requirements, formats, and instructions provided by the client. They are conducted by multi-disciplinary teams under tight deadlines, often with no clear technical solution at the outset. Techniques we take agile, iterative, or spiral developers include: Communications methods each morning they have a 15 minute scrum to communicate status and risk quickly. I have been trying this technique for the past month if often works. Techniques we take from iterative or agile developers include: producing chunks or parts of code that are workable instead of completing everything from start to finish. For example, if your working on an HR system, you chunk your work into teams creating a hiring, training or retention sub-system. Different teams can be working on different chunks simultaneously. In the case of the proposal team you might also chunk the solution and have different groups work on the telecommunications, production, and reporting systems simultaneously. Instead of reviewing all these chunks all at one time in a storyboard, pink, and then red team reviews, consider smaller SME and management reviews on each chunk as they progress.
